This compelling fresco mural, "The Voice of the Water," captures a moment in time through vivid colours and intricate details. Painted by Will Shuster in 1934, it portrays Native Americans gathered in a serene moment, connecting deeply with nature and their heritage. The artwork invites viewers to reflect on their relationship with water, symbolising life and unity.
